At the SC22 plenary this week several things were decided on email.

SC22 have asked for email services to be used thruout the SC, and
I volunteered to undertake this service.

A naming scheme were decided which could be used for the whole
of JTC1  - after a proposal from Britain. It is 

   SC<n>WG<m>

I have thus created the new lists SC22WG14 SC22WG15 and SC22WG15RIN.
The old lists wg14 wg15 and wg15rin are retained for convenience,
but they are just an alias for the newer lists.
The *-request lists (in most cases just an alias for me) have also been
changed, and I have not retained the old *-request addresses.

Note that the new lists have capital letters, but that is
not significant when mailing.

The mailings now have a dot "." in the reference numbering,
this is along the lines being used in WG14. It is meant for
easy reference and identification in other email or in WG papers.

I have thought of removing the parenthesises around the
sequence reference, to allow longer real subjects.
Comments wanted!

For SC22WG14 and SC22WG15 mailings a new service is available.
All back articles and some more information is available via
FTP and email. The following files exist:

           <number>    the sequence number
           list        the email address list
           latest      the latest article number received

They reside in the directory dkuug.dk:JTC1/SC22/WG14 or WG15 .
The internet number is 129.142.96.41. FTAM is also available.
To get access  via email, send a mail to

    archive@dkuug.dk
    Subject: files JTC1/SC22/WG14
    Names: list 22

(gets article number 22 and the address list for WG14).

Please note that case is significant with this email service
and also with FTP and FTAM. Help is available with a subject of
"help" to the archive server, or if you make an error...

This service is not available to WG15RIN, as there are 
copyrighted material in the archive. I would like this to be discussed
on email in SC22WG15RIN. 

If any problems occur, please notify me.
